The Faith School District is a public school district in Meade County, based in Faith, South Dakota.
Serving 72 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Faith Elementary - 02 ranks in the top 20% of all schools in South Dakota for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60-69% (which is higher than the South Dakota state average of 42%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-59% (which is approximately equal to the South Dakota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is equal to the South Dakota state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 21% of the student body (majority American Indian and Asian), which is lower than the South Dakota state average of 33% (majority American Indian).

Faith Elementary - 02's student population of 72 students has grown by 5% over five school years.
The teacher population of 6 teachers has grown by 20% over five school years.
